What is the ACS Award for Team Innovation?

The ACS Award for Team Innovation acknowledges teams who have demonstrated exceptional collaborative innovation in chemical science. It goes beyond recognizing individual brilliance, focusing on the collective effort, shared vision, and collaborative spirit that lead to impactful results. This award showcases the increasingly collaborative nature of modern chemical research and the power of diverse skillsets working together towards a common goal. The award emphasizes the importance of teamwork in solving complex chemical problems and driving progress in various areas of the field.

What are the criteria for the ACS Award for Team Innovation?

While the specific criteria might vary slightly from year to year, the core principles remain consistent. The ACS typically seeks nominations for teams whose work exemplifies:

  • Significant scientific impact: The research must have made a substantial contribution to the field of chemistry, demonstrably advancing knowledge or technology.
  • Exceptional collaboration: The nomination should highlight the unique collaborative aspects of the project, showcasing the synergy between team members and how their diverse skills complemented each other.
  • Innovation: The work must be innovative, demonstrating a novel approach, method, or technology in chemical research.
  • Teamwork and leadership: Evidence of effective teamwork, shared leadership, and a collaborative spirit is crucial for consideration.
  • Broader impact: The team's work should ideally demonstrate a positive impact beyond the immediate scientific community, potentially impacting industry, society, or the environment.
